科普 | 信頼を必要としないシステムとは?それは金融業界にどのような変化をもたらすのか?
原文标题:《DAOrayaki |信頼のないシステムとは何か》
撰文:Samantha Marin
翻译:Dewei
Bankless DAOでは、私たちはしばしばブロックチェーン技術を金融革命と呼びます。なぜなら、スマートコントラクトが信頼不要で許可不要のシステムを作り出したからです。しかし、最初の言葉である「信頼のない」というのは、本当に何を意味するのでしょうか?
まず、信頼のないということは、信頼に値しないという同義語ではないことを理解する必要があります。あるシステムが信頼を必要としないということは、人間や機関に対する信頼なしにそのシステムが機能することを意味します——それは人間の介入なしに起こるのです。
これは今聞くと混乱を招くかもしれませんが、私は深く掘り下げて、以下に例を示します。
信頼のないシステムを理解するためには、まず信頼されたシステムまたは信頼に基づくシステムを理解する必要があります。これが私たちが今日生活している世界です。
信頼されたシステムまたは信頼に基づくシステムの定義
古くから、人間は信頼に頼って協力してきました。以下はその例です:
銀行にお金を預けるとき、あなたは銀行があなたのお金を保管してくれると信じています。必要なときに引き出すことができます。
Robinhoodで取引を開始するとき、あなたはRobinhoodが取引を実行してくれると信じています。資産の取引を凍結するのではなく。
Venmoを通じて友人に送金するとき、あなたはVenmoがあなたの友人の口座にお金を振り込んでくれると信じています。他の誰かの口座にではなく。
信頼に基づくシステムは私たちの社会に浸透しています。上記の例が示すように、それらは間違いを犯しやすいのです。
発展途上国に住む人々や通貨が不安定な国に住む人々にとって、政府の官僚や腐敗した政治家に自分の財政や生活を委ねることが間違いであることは何度も証明されています。
21世紀以前には、信頼できるシステムのない世界を想像することはできませんでした。しかし、ブロックチェーン技術のおかげで、すべてが変わりつつあります。
信頼のないシステムの定義
信頼のないシステムとは、参加者が特定の方法で行動することに依存せずに期待される結果を達成するシステムです。システムは人間に依存せずに操作を実行します。銀行やブローカーのような仲介者がイベントを調整することはありません。あなたは、あなたとやり取りする人が信頼できるかどうかを心配する必要はありません。システムがあなたのために信頼を構築します。
銀行があなたのお金を保管する必要はなく、人があなたのリンゴの木を避ける必要もなく、僧侶が情報を伝える必要もありません。仲介者も促進者もおらず、コードがタスクを実行します。
スマートコントラクトは信頼のないシステムです。ブロックチェーン技術は、ユーザー間の信頼のない相互作用を促進するためにスマートコントラクトを使用します。
分解してみましょう:
異なる国から来た異なる言語を話す見知らぬ人々は、仲介者なしでトークンを送受信できます。スマートコントラクトが彼らの取引を実行します。それは、コードに書かれたif, thenの論理文を使用して指示を実行します。ユーザーは、取引を実行する個人や実体の道徳的地位ではなく、コードの健全性を信頼します。
あなたは誰かを信頼する必要はなく、その人を置き換えてコードを信頼するのです。
さらに、取引記録はコミュニティ全体に保存されます:情報を保持する中央機関、たとえばGoogleのようなものではなく、コミュニティ全体が分散型ネットワークを通じて保持します。取引の複数のコピーが世界中のコンピュータに保存されているため、どの機関もこれらの取引の履歴を改ざんすることはできません。
しかし、重要なのは、完全に本質的に信頼のないシステムは存在しないということです。ブロックチェーンとスマートコントラクトは最初に人間によって構築されており、そのコードは他の人によってレビューされる必要があります。しかし、信頼のないシステムに近づくためには努力が必要です。ユーザーがさまざまな動機や道徳を持つことを許可するシステムが整えば、人々はより安心して安全に協力でき、契約は依然として取引を実行します。
if, thenの文は、あなたの道徳や取引相手の道徳に関係なく実行されます。
ユーザーはどのようにしてコードが信頼できるかを知ることができますか?
スマートコントラクトがブロックチェーンにデプロイされると、そのコードは公開アクセス可能になります。ほとんどのプロジェクトには、コミュニティが読むための公共のGithubと大量の文書があるため、ユーザーは自分で調査してスマートコントラクトと相互作用することを望むかどうかを判断できます。
スマートコントラクトは不変であり、一度ブロックチェーンにデプロイされると、悪意のある開発者がコードの機能を変更することはできません。したがって、このシステムは信頼のないものと見なすことができます。なぜなら、ユーザーは悪意のある行為者や開発者が権力を濫用して、GameStopの圧迫中に取引能力を凍結したり、ユーザーのデータを知らずに収集して販売したりすることができないと信じているからです。(信頼がどのように私たちを失望させるかが見え始めましたか?)
ユーザーは本当にすべてを自分で検証できるのか?
新しいプロトコルやプロジェクトがリリースされると、人々はコードに潜在的な問題がないか分析します。しかし、ユーザーは悪意のある行為者が何かを改ざんしていないことを確認するために、すべての新しいブロックが鋳造されるのを見守ることはありません。これには一連の保護措置があり、後の文章で詳しく説明します。
プルーフ・オブ・ステークとプルーフ・オブ・ワークは、ブロックチェーンがブロックを鋳造し、そのブロックが安全か悪意のあるものかを判断するために使用するコンセンサスメカニズムです。この2つのシステムは異なる方法で機能しますが、悪意のあるブロックが鋳造されるのを防ぐことができます。これらの保護措置は、システムの信頼のない化をもたらします。
どんな形の通貨の交換にも信頼は必要ないのか?
最高レベルでは、はい。個人はトークンが価値を持つことを受け入れなければなりません。たとえば、彼らはETHが他の資産と取引する価値のあるデジタル資産であることを受け入れなければなりません。これは、現金を使用する人々が取引する現金が価値があることを受け入れなければならないのと似ています。
希少で取引可能な価値の保存(通貨)を信頼することは、単なる物々交換の社会から、異なる利益を持つ人々が価値を交換して求めるものを得ることができる社会への移行に必要です。
TLDR
私たちの現在の信頼に基づく世界では、取引やシステムが間違いを犯すことがあります。なぜなら、私たちは人間にそれらを実行し維持することを依存しているからです。私たちは信頼のないシステムを使用して、イベントを自主的に実行し記録することができ、人間の道徳や仲介者に依存する必要はありません。
完全に信頼のないシステムは存在しません。なぜなら、すべては最初に人々によって構築されなければならないからです。一度プロジェクトがブロックチェーン上で立ち上がり、稼働すると、スマートコントラクトは変更できません。従来の階層は取り除かれ、異なる道徳や価値観を持つユーザーが協力することができます。